Abstract
⺠1/3 of epilepsy patients continue to have seizures despite adequate drug treatment. ⺠Chronotherapy could be a promising treatment option. ⺠We compared behavior of circadian types in relation to the times of taking drugs. ⺠Morning types take AEDs earlier than evening types on free and work days (mornings). ⺠Regardless of circadian type, drugs on free days are taken later than on work days.
